I feel really bad about the one missed moves. I picked up a abandoned position with 2 day deadlines, but apparently nearly all of that time had already been used and the deadline passed as I was just starting to send messages to other players. I thought it was a site bug. I did not know that picking up a position did not restart the clock. If you have minutes to make your moves on an abandoned position you really just have to move blind without any correspondence.
